Output c8427b4d955dd2318ade5a2431cda1389d49f5028159cad659074a1fd67b87b0:3

value
66491414
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e6c571355a67f14935c99f47cd89cbc905cab70b OP_EQUALVERIFY OP_CHECKSIG
address
1N3CweXQMEcvDAWNbNstad2FY7GWpeqWdg
transaction
c8427b4d955dd2318ade5a2431cda1389d49f5028159cad659074a1fd67b87b0
confirmations
507181
spent
true